diff options
author | Claudio Mignanti <c.mignanti@gmail.com> | 2009-07-05 09:45:34 +0000 |
---|---|---|
committer | Claudio Mignanti <c.mignanti@gmail.com> | 2009-07-05 09:45:34 +0000 |
commit | 7505306668bf15732db0dfdf1c2e119403b6bdfc (patch) | |
tree | 4b3375eb83290bf36aa33be359d49e45ae9d2314 /target/linux/etrax/files-2.6.30/arch/cris/arch-v10/drivers/i2c_errno.h | |
parent | 1bbbf71817718db7e048c496e74fce46f80d01e4 (diff) | |
download | upstream-7505306668bf15732db0dfdf1c2e119403b6bdfc.tar.gz upstream-7505306668bf15732db0dfdf1c2e119403b6bdfc.tar.bz2 upstream-7505306668bf15732db0dfdf1c2e119403b6bdfc.zip |
[etrax] also include i2c driver inside 2.6.30
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@16679 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'target/linux/etrax/files-2.6.30/arch/cris/arch-v10/drivers/i2c_errno.h')
-rw-r--r-- | target/linux/etrax/files-2.6.30/arch/cris/arch-v10/drivers/i2c_errno.h | 20 |
1 files changed, 20 insertions, 0 deletions
diff --git a/target/linux/etrax/files-2.6.30/arch/cris/arch-v10/drivers/i2c_errno.h b/target/linux/etrax/files-2.6.30/arch/cris/arch-v10/drivers/i2c_errno.h new file mode 100644 index 0000000000..7de4ad62c0 --- /dev/null +++ b/target/linux/etrax/files-2.6.30/arch/cris/arch-v10/drivers/i2c_errno.h @@ -0,0 +1,20 @@ +#ifndef _I2C_ERRNO_H
+#define _I2C_ERRNO_H
+
+#define EI2CNOERRORS 0 /* All fine */
+#define EI2CBUSNFREE 1 /* I2C bus not free */
+#define EI2CWADDRESS 2 /* Address write failed */
+#define EI2CRADDRESS 3 /* Address read failed */
+#define EI2CSENDDATA 4 /* Sending data failed */
+#define EI2CRECVDATA 5 /* Receiving data failed */
+#define EI2CSTRTCOND 6 /* Start condition failed */
+#define EI2CRSTACOND 7 /* Repeated start condition failed */
+#define EI2CSTOPCOND 8 /* Stop condition failed */
+#define EI2CNOSNDBYT 9 /* Number of send bytes is 0, while there's a send buffer defined */
+#define EI2CNOSNDBUF 10 /* No send buffer defined, while number of send bytes is not 0 */
+#define EI2CNORCVBYT 11 /* Number of receive bytes is 0, while there's a receive buffer defined */
+#define EI2CNORCVBUF 12 /* No receive buffer defined, while number of receive bytes is not 0 */
+#define EI2CNOACKNLD 13 /* No acknowledge received from slave */
+#define EI2CNOMNUMBR 14 /* No MAJOR number received from kernel while registering the device */
+
+#endif /* _I2C_ERRNO_H */
|